Hi, There is a growing number of Android phones/devices out there in the wild, and having a BOINC port for Android (Boincoid) would allow the BOINC community to tap on this vast computing power. The idea is for the Boincoid users to switch on the processing at night, when their Android phone/device is charging and idle. Please reply to this thread if you pledge to try Boincoid on your Android phone/device once the port is ready*. You can specify your phone model and MFLOPS** details if you know them. Is there anyone interested in reigniting the Boincoid Android port for BOINC? I was made aware of Boincoid a few days ago and I would like to help gather interest in this project again. There was a Workshop in 2011 with some work done in having BOINC working on the Android platform: http://boinc.berkeley.edu/trac/wiki/WorkShop11/HackFest/Android#no1 |
